Few hotels in the west of Scotland have such a long and distinguished history as the Argyll Hotel. Designed in 1750 by the famous Scottish builder John Adam, the Argyll was the one the first buildings completed during the total redesign and building of Inveraray, commissioned by the 3rd Duke of Argyll. The Argyll was originally built as a coaching inn, to accommodate guests to court.

The interior of the Argyll reflects upon this impressive history, and the elegant style of its renowned creator.
